The surname 'Striebe' is of Germanic origin, derived from the Middle High German word 'sträube,' meaning 'curl' or 'tuft of hair.' It is believed to have originated as a nickname for someone with curly or unkempt hair. The surname may have also been used to describe someone with a spirited or rebellious personality, as the word 'sträube' can also mean 'to resist' or 'to oppose.'
German surnames often reflect aspects of an individual's physical appearance, occupation, or personal characteristics. In the case of the surname 'Striebe,' it is likely that the name was originally given to someone with curly or unruly hair, and has since been passed down through generations as a family name.
The surname 'Striebe' has several variations and spellings, including 'Strieb,' 'Striebel,' and 'Strub.' These variations may have arisen due to regional dialects, migration patterns, or other historical factors. Despite these variations, the core meaning of the name remains consistent, referring to curly or unkempt hair.

The surname 'Striebe' has a relatively high incidence in Germany, with a prevalence of 115 individuals bearing the name. This suggests that the surname is relatively common in German-speaking regions, particularly in areas where the name may have originated or been traditionally associated.
In the United States, the surname 'Striebe' has a lower incidence compared to Germany, with only 28 individuals bearing the name. This may be due to factors such as immigration patterns, assimilation of foreign surnames, or various other historical influences that have impacted the prevalence of the name in American society.
In South Africa, the surname 'Striebe' has a relatively low incidence, with only 6 individuals bearing the name. This suggests that the surname is less common in South African society compared to Germany or the United States.
